<P>PROBLEM TO BE SOLVED: To provide an image forming apparatus in which occurrence of image fog is reliably suppressed and a clear image of high image quality is reliably obtained, even when a high-speed image forming process using a small particle diameter toner is applied. <P>SOLUTION: In the image forming apparatus, a rotating image forming member is charged and exposed to form an electrostatic latent image, and the image forming member is rubbed with a magnetic brush of a two-component developer consisting of a toner and a carrier formed on a developer carrier disposed opposite to the image forming member by way of a development region. An electric field for development prepared by superposing an alternating electric field on a DC electric field is formed in the development region, whereby the electrostatic latent image is subjected to reversal development and normal rotation development to form a toner image. The toner has a volume average particle diameter of 3-5 μm, the carrier has a volume average particle diameter of 15-50 μm and an intensity of magnetization of 30-80 emu/g, and the developing process is carried out in a state satisfying specified conditions. <P>COPYRIGHT: (C)2005,JPO&NCIPI |
